Footwear is without doubt one of the most necessary gadgets in your Kilimanjaro pack checklist. That is the place try to be significantly attentive and selective. Selecting your mountain climbing boots and/or sneakers is a process of supreme significance. A unsuitable alternative right here can lead to damaged toenails, corns and blisters. For this journey you have to high-quality mountain climbing boots, trekking sneakers (non-compulsory) and trekking socks.

Mountain climbing boots Selecting acceptable mountain climbing boots might be of utmost significance. There are numerous choices in the marketplace, and typically it‟s arduous to search out the appropriate one. Ideally, your mountain climbing boots ought to meet the next standards:

  • Boots ought to have good ankle assist.
  • Boots ought to be of medium weight.
  • After all, your boots ought to be waterproof to maintain your toes dry all the way in which as much as the highest. It’s particularly necessary within the summit space in case you climb Kilimanjaro through the wet season. Sporting high-quality trekking socks will present additional safety, so it’s at all times beneficial to have a pair.

Ideally, laces ought to get mounted to the pace hooks for higher consolation and safety. It’s critically necessary to interrupt in your boots earlier than the beginning of your Kilimanjaro journey. Taking a pair of name new boots will trigger discomfort, sore soles and calluses. Due to this fact, it’s extremely beneficial so that you can put on your boots for about 5-6 days earlier than the beginning of the trek. It’s critically necessary to interrupt in your boots earlier than the beginning of your Kilimanjaro journey. It is best to take at the very least two lengthy hikes to get them prepared.

The manufacturers of mountain climbing boots that we advocate embrace: La Sportiva, Zamberlan, The North Face, merles, Asolo, Salomon and Scarpa. Any of those manufacturers can be good for Kilimanjaro.

  • Sneakers Elective On some routes, the primary days of your hike received’t be very steep, making it doable to make use of easy trekking sneakers as a substitute of trainers. On the next days, after arriving at your camp, you’ll most likely wish to take off your mountain climbing boots and let your toes relaxation. That’s when sneakers would possibly turn out to be useful. They’ll be good for exploring the camp environment and to maneuver between your tent and eating tents.
  • Trekking socks Trekking socks are a should on hikes like this. Don’t pack cotton socks, as they may retain sweat and provide you with blisters. In distinction, woolen socks are an excellent choice for Kilimanjaro – they may guarantee quick and efficient wicking. A model to select from is Bridgedale.
  • Thermal socks Elective Thermal socks are non-compulsory, however extremely beneficial, particularly for climbs through the summer time months. There are a whole lot of manufacturers accessible in the marketplace. Those with flat seams, not manufactured from cotton, will go well with completely! Merino wool is a superb various.
  • Gaiters Elective Using gaiters on Kilimanjaro just isn’t necessary, however through the wet season they’re completely indispensable to stop mud, snow or pebbles from getting contained in the boots.

Hikers typically suppose that gaiters are of little worth. And but, they do assist to maintain your trekking pants and boots clear through the trek, making your clothes extra nice to placed on. Additionally, the gaiters assist to guard your costlier membrane and trekking pants from the edgy rocks that are ubiquitous on Kilimanjaro.

Head-Gears

Like different trekking gear classes, Kilimanjaro headgear has each necessary and non-compulsory gadgets.

  • Solar hat A solar hat is a will need to have in your packing checklist. Ideally, it also needs to have a neck cowl (like this one). This headgear will defend your face from sunburns and overheating.
  • Beanie Taking a beanie is important for this journey. At increased elevation you’ll begin feeling chilly, so as a way to preserve your head and ears heat you have to an excellent beanie. It ought to be heat sufficient for the low temperatures and snowy circumstances of the summit space.
  • Balaclava Elective Balaclava is a useful answer for hikers who’re significantly prone to chilly temperatures. A woolen balaclava will defend your chin, nostril, cheeks and brow from wind on the summit evening. It’s unlikely that you’ll be utilizing it anyplace else.
  • Neck hotter Elective Many climbers discover neck heaters very helpful as they supply good safety to your neck and face if it will get very chilly. It‟s additionally an excellent answer towards mud.
  • Sun shades On the subject of sun shades, there are some key factors to concentrate to. Firstly, sun shades ought to present good UV safety. On the elevation of 6,000 m above the ocean degree UV radiation is far increased than at sea degree. Secondly, when selecting sun shades, you need to keep in mind that snow within the summit space displays mild, thus placing additional pressure in your eyes. As soon as close to the summit, you need to put your sun shades on even whether it is cloudy. In any other case, you would possibly develop a situation often called snow blindness. It is rather harmful and should trigger everlasting injury to your imaginative and prescient. Thus, be sure that to decide on a high-quality mountain mannequin with 3 or, higher, 4-level of UV safety.
  • Headlamp You cannot hike Mount Kilimanjaro with out a headlamp. Firstly, you’ll want it for shifting across the camp after sundown when discovering your tent can turn into fairly a process. Apart from, in case you determine to go to the lavatory at evening with out a headlamp on, you might come upon the tent ropes. Secondly, a headlamp can be needed through the summit. Usually, hikers begin at midnight, aiming to succeed in Uhuru Peak by dawn. So a headlamp can be an excellent assist in seeing the trail.

Please take note of the next factors whereas selecting a headlamp to your journey:

  • Verify the standard of sunshine. The brighter your headlamp, the extra appropriate it’s for the trek. Optimally, the sunshine output ought to be increased than 90-100 lumens and the beam distance ought to be at the very least 40-50 m.
  • Purchase good batteries. Ideally, the energetic mode ought to be round 30 hours. In any other case, don’t forget to take spare batteries or you should buy it right here.
  • Lastly, your headlamp shouldn’t be too heavy. Since it’s worn on the top, it ought to be comparatively mild. Thus, don’t think about something above 120 g.
  • Keep away from shopping for headlamps with rechargeable batteries. Their battery life is far shorter, and, most significantly, there are not any energy retailers on Kilimanjaro to recharge them.

PETZL offers good choices – test them out.

Trekking poles

Trekking poles are a extremely beneficial merchandise in your Kilimanjaro packing checklist, not solely as a result of it’s a matter of consolation, however due to well being issues. Excessive-altitude trekking is a strenuous exercise that places nice pressure in your knees and joints. The common day by day mountain climbing leg on Mt Kilimanjaro is 7-10 km, which takes 4-8 hours to finish.

The terrain is rugged and, at some factors of the trek, rocky. That is the place the trekking poles will make it easier to to maintain steadiness, including two additional supporting factors. The hikers additionally say that the trekking poles are useful on the summit evening, particularly when fatigue takes over them. That’s the reason some individuals who don’t use trekking poles complain about sore legs throughout and after the journey.

Good trekking poles will reduce the influence of a prolonged hike on joints, since a part of your weight can be moved upon your fingers and again, relieving your knees and different joints from additional stress.

Whereas deciding on the trekking poles to your Kilimanjaro hike take note of the next:

  • Ideally, your trekking poles ought to weigh round 400 g—not too heavy and never too mild. Sturdiness additionally issues—they need to be capable to endure prolonged hikes.
  • As for supplies, aluminum is probably the most optimum choice to make the poles sturdy. Additionally, test the grip supplies – in a high-quality pair of poles, grips are manufactured from cork or foam. Cork is at all times a greater choice, because it feels extra snug within the palm and doesn’t injury the palm pores and skin.
  • Additionally, keep in mind that the trekking poles ought to match your peak. Other than adjustable fashions, there are particular fashions for tall individuals and for teenagers.

Black Diamond is understood for having the best assortment of trekking poles. Good trekking poles are precisely what you’ll want to reduce the influence of a prolonged hike in your knees and joints.

Gloves You have to two sorts of gloves for this journey – mild internal gloves and hotter outer gloves for the summit evening. Each sorts of gloves are important to your Kilimanjaro journey.

Light-weight gloves are supposed to preserve your fingers heat ranging from the second day of your expedition. Most hikers put on them till the summit camp after which placed on their outer gloves. Inside gloves ought to be manufactured from good-quality supplies, the most effective choices being wool, polartec or synthetics. Keep away from shopping for cotton gloves—they don’t seem to be appropriate for Kilimanjaro due to their poor wicking capability.

Additionally, you will want heat gloves or mittens for the summit evening. They need to be heat and waterproof, whereas snug to make use of. Mittens are higher – the summit normally takes round eight hours, and on a regular basis you’ll be holding trekking poles in your fingers. Due to that, it’s crucial to maintain them heat at -15°C / 5°F (lowest temperature within the summit zone).

Sleeping bag for Kilimanjaro

Regardless of which season you might be climbing Mount Kilimanjaro, a sleeping bag can be needed in any camp and on all routes.

Your sleeping bag ought to be heat. To start with, your sleeping bag has three temperature ranges.

  • “Consolation degree” means the temperature at which you’ll be able to sleep comfortably in your sleeping bag with solely your thermal underwear on.
  • “Restrict degree” stands for the temperature when you should use your sleeping bag whereas carrying some layers of additional garments. Sleeping baggage shouldn’t be utilized in circumstances past that temperature restrict.
  • “Excessive degree” means the temperature at which a sleeping bag can be utilized as an emergency measure to save lots of a climber from hypothermia till the emergency providers arrive.

It is rather chilly at evening within the higher camps of Kilimanjaro. Thus, the consolation degree of your sleeping bag ought to be at the very least -10°C / 14°F. If you may get a sleeping bag hotter than that, you received’t remorse it! Nobody has ever complained that it was too sizzling in his or her sleeping bag.

Ideally, your sleeping bag ought to have a hood to cowl your head for higher sleep at evening. Our Kilimanjaro suggestion is Lamina Z Blaze (Consolation Stage -15°F / -26°C) by Mountain Hardwear and The North Face sleeping baggage.

  • Sleeping bag liner Elective A sleeping bag liner will add additional heat on the ultimate days of your climb. Mummy-shaped liners are higher than rectangular ones. Both a fleece or an insulated liner can be nice to your Kilimanjaro hike. An excellent liner can add from 3 to eight°C to your sleeping bag consolation degree, which lets you take your individual sleeping bag if it doesn’t match the -10°C consolation degree requirement.
  • Inflatable pillow Elective An inflatable pillow can be of nice use for individuals who like studying in a tent. On the similar time, nonetheless, chances are you’ll put your again pack or some garments below your head to make an improvised pillow.
  • Private & Medical gadgets Elective Moist wipes will assist preserve private hygiene in case you determined to climb Kilimanjaro with out hiring a private moveable bathe. Take two packs – put a small one into your daypack to make use of on the way in which, and a bigger one will go to the duffel bag for use for the night hygiene. Suncream. With out it the open elements of your fingers and face will simply get sunburnt. Private medicine – you need to undoubtedly carry any drugs chances are you’ll require similar to nausea, headache, stomachache, and many others. Do not forget that a number of the drugs which you could simply purchase within the dwelling nations may be unavailable in Tanzania.

Elective Devices

A few of the devices that can be helpful in your Kilimanjaro journey are:

  • Digicam—The surroundings opening from Mt Kilimanjaro is really spectacular! Taking nice photos is without doubt one of the primary causes individuals join this journey. It’s possible you’ll take a smartphone with an influence financial institution or a Go-Professional digicam with spare batteries to seize probably the most incredible moments of your journey.
  • Energy banks—As stated above, if you’re taking any devices with you, taking an influence financial institution is a should. There are not any energy retailers on Kilimanjaro, and it’s the solely method to preserve your smartphone, e-reader or different units charged.
  • E-book—For many who wish to learn earlier than going to sleep, it’s a must-have merchandise within the packing checklist.
  • Mp3 Participant—It will make your Kilimanjaro Trek actually nice, particularly on the summit evening. Your favourite songs will definitely sustain your spirits and make the moments on the highest of Africa much more great. (Elective)

REMEMBER: Communal gear (tents, meals, utensils, and many others.) is supplied. You might be chargeable for bringing the required, beneficial and non-compulsory private gear and gear listed. The commonest mistake that climbers make is that they overpack. Be selective in what you are taking with you. Our porters are restricted to carrying 33 lbs. (15 kgs) of your belongings.
